OPEN JOB: Specialist Trade Compliance (ITAR Export Classifications and Jurisdictions)LOCATION:Melbourne FL or Rochester NY(candidate choice)
**Relocation Assistance Available **This is a fully onsite position; No hybrid or remote option will be offered.SALARY: $82000 to $115000INDUSTRY:Aerospace / Aviation / DefenseIdeal Candidate
The ideal candidate will have experience in the aerospace and defense industry with knowledge/experience in ITAR export classifications & jurisdiction analysis.Job DetailsJob Schedule: 9/80: Employees work 9 out of every 14 days totaling 80 hours worked and have every other Friday offJob Description:- Seeking a Specialist Trade Compliance for our Communication Systems (CS) Segment. This role will be responsible for conducting Export Controlled Information review and jurisdiction classification duties across the CS segment.
Essential Functions:- Conduct ITAR and EAR export jurisdiction and classification reviews of hardware software and technical data
- Provide export classifications to support licensing and agreement applications
- Conduct custom classifications (HTS and Schedule B)
- Perform review and provides approval of technical data transfers to international third parties
- Perform review and provides approval for the companys information placed in the public domain
- Implement trade compliance policies in accordance with U.S. Export Regulations
- Participate in the planning and execution of Trade Compliance audits
- Develop and deploy training
- Complete annual SME training
- Identify and recommend process improvements
- Report to the Manager Technical Trade Compliance in the Communications Systems Segment of the company
- Determine and document export and customs classifications
- Ensure compliance with ITAR EAR and Customs regulations including providing compliance guidance to both internal and external customers.
- Efficiently and effectively manages workload to include competing priorities and deadlines ensuring on-time completion of activities
- Uses thorough understanding and knowledge of the ITAR and EAR regulations in everyday job duties
Qualifications:- Bachelors Degree and a minimum of 4 years of prior related experience. Graduate Degree or equivalent with 2 years of prior related lieu of a degree minimum of 8 years of prior related experience
- ITAR experience
- Export classifications
- Export jurisdictions
Preferred Additional Skills:- Experience with tactical radios
- Familiar with software code
- Engineering Degree or equivalent technical experience
- Customs regulations experience
- Familiarity with LO/CLO and Anti-Tamper requirements
- EAR CAT 5 Part 2 working knowledge
- Experience with OCR EASE
- Experience with Agile PDM
- Experience with software defined radio
